Output 2f509de5c5707723ae8f8a2c7cdd387696115653a079eb20ade3f7815052f2e6:1

value
15336684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28f9699ae1afbd9b1623cf0466321150c490f062 OP_EQUAL
address
35RfjhhvJ4ZQLm9Jm2pCAbaCjf9SYPeVDX
transaction
2f509de5c5707723ae8f8a2c7cdd387696115653a079eb20ade3f7815052f2e6
spent
true